Listening to the sounds of the village men matching, voices of women and children singing and chanting as they walked, swayed their babies on the back and worked in the open fields of corn, coffee and banana plantations, as well as on the school yards, Sheela Langeberg knew from a very young age, that she wanted to create her own music and keep those rich tunes, stories and riddles of her people alive.

In DREAM Album, Sheela Langeberg has overlaid her unique voice octaves, used her expertise in traditional storytelling techniques as well as the Tanzanian landscape, colour and life style and blended those with modern instruments to give a characterization of each track.

Ndito the Masai Girl
A detailed story of Ndito the Masai Girl written by Sheela Langeberg.

Ndito the Masai Girl, is a story about a little nomad girl. It's a story about dreams, courage, determination and a little bit of attitude.

On the way to fulfill her life long dream of meeting with her favourite birds the Marabou, Flamingos and the Peacock, Ndito is faced by many obstacles.

First, Ndito must sing in concert with the rain, then she must go past the home of Mama Yeyo -a very old crone feared by all. Mama Yeyo had no teeth, no hair and no family of her own. She would always sit in her door way talking to herself and waiting for her death that never came soon enough. At least that's what all the villagers thought. Mama Yeyo would say things that really came true. Then Ndito must go past the home of Mzee -a very old man with no teeth-not even one, no hair, no bottom-not even a little one and family of his own either. He would sit on the lawns infront of his little red hut and talk to his little imaginary friend who seemed to be sitting on Mzee's right shoulder. Mzee had the most compelling eyes. Day and night he would dance with big frogs and mud crabs and force everyone passing by to join in .Lastly but not the least, Ndito must go past the home of two umbilical twin brothers and their mysterious friend called DOTI. And the adventures of the story start here.
